Yaml syntax home assistant. yaml. The standards described on this page, apply to all our YAML based code across the project, with the main focus on documentation. A first example The following YAML example entry assumes that you would like to set up the notify integration with the pushbullet Create and debug Home Assistant automations, scripts, blueprints, and Jinja2 templates. sh startup script. The UI will write your automations to automations. This add-on allows to edit your Home Assistant configuration straight from the web browser. Is it more efficient to create template entities in Helpers, YAML, or to use templates directly in the dashboard, automations YAML Style Guide In addition to our general documentation standards, we also have a set of standards for documenting snippets of YAML. For information about editing basic settings through the UI Nov 14, 2025 · Home Assistant relies heavily on YAML configuration files, and for anyone unfamiliar with this markup language, even simple automations can feel like an uphill battle. yaml Structure The config. yaml file defines the add-on metadata, default values, and validation schema that Home Assistant uses to generate the This book accompanies you step by step: from the basics of YAML syntax to automations, templates and helpers to packages, blueprints and professional dashboard solutions. To find the configuration directory To look up the path to your configuration directory, go to Settings > System > Repairs. io/alexxit/go2rtc support multiple architectures including 386, amd64, arm/v6, arm/v7 and arm64. These containers offer the same functionality as the Home Assistant add-on but are designed to operate independently of Home Assistant. Quick Reload: This reloads all configuration files without stopping the actual service. config. Restart Home Assistant: This fully stops and starts the Core service. YAML Style Guide This page gives a high-level introduction to the YAML syntax used in Home Assistant. Restart in Safe Mode: This starts the service with all custom integrations and themes disabled, which is invaluable for troubleshooting. Jan 17, 2024 · One of the easiest ways to edit the configuration. A first example The following YAML example entry assumes that you would like to set up the notify integration with the pushbullet Oct 16, 2024 · The new & improved YAML syntax for Home Assistant automations is a welcome change for most users. 3 days ago · The add-on uses a two-stage configuration system: a schema definition in config. 2 days ago · Use AI to create, debug, and optimize Home Assistant automations without memorizing YAML syntax or service calls. Build a powerful foundation now. "description": "Create and manage Home Assistant YAML configuration files including automations, scripts, templates, blueprints, Lovelace dashboards, and file organization. yaml, splitting configuration across multiple files using !include directives, organizing configuration with packages, managing secrets, and YAML syntax requirements. It provides live syntax checking and auto-fill of various Home Assistant entities. For a more detailed description and more examples, refer to the YAML Style Guide for Home Assistant developers. Each concept is explained using specific home assistant examples that you can add directly to your system. However, even when there’s no human or any moving object in the room, the sensor still detects presence for about 5–7 seconds occasionally. Jan 2, 2026 · It is the fastest way to apply YAML changes. 1 day ago · Ready to supercharge your smart home? Our 2026 guide walks you through the essential Home Assistant setup, including MQTT, Samba, and Code Server. If you want to edit the YAML of an automation, select the automation, select the menu button in the top right then on Edit in YAML. go2rtc: Docker The Docker containers alexxit/go2rtc and ghcr. YAML Style Guide This page gives a high-level introduction to the YAML syntax used in Home Assistant. Automation YAML Automations are created in Home Assistant via the UI, but are stored in a YAML format. Hello everyone, I’ve connected the HLK-LD2410C Human Presence Sensor with an ESP32 using ESPHome firmware and integrated it into Home Assistant. It brings consistency, clarity, and ease of use, especially for those who are just getting started with Home Assistant. Nov 22, 2025 · Configuration File Management Relevant source files This document covers the structure and organization of Home Assistant's configuration files, including configuration. If you prefer to use a file editor on your computer, use the Samba app. json by the run. . This editor offers live syntax checking and auto-fill of various Home Assistant entities. Indentation mistakes, missing colons, or small syntax errors can turn what should be a straightforward setup into a frustrating debugging session. But it looks more complex than the file editor. 3 days ago · Through the MCP protocol, users can efficiently manage configuration files across multiple Home Assistant instances, with features including YAML validation, automatic backups, and local file saving. What awaits you: • Understand YAML syntax and use it safely. yaml that generates the UI, and runtime processing of /data/options. It comes preinstalled with FFmpeg and Python. Developed in Python, it supports installation via pip, uvx, or source code. yaml file is by installing the Visual Studio Code add-on that can be embedded straight into the Home Assistant UI. Use when working with triggers, conditions, actions, automation YAML, scripts Join Home Decor & DIY 2K members Join What is the most efficient way to create template entities in Home Assistant? Brad Applegate Home Assistant 1y · Public I'm looking for advice on templating in Home Assistant. whbopyb ckxs zjdcpr codfguq gqigv mcalr yvw ynfvcqu hgv vdoe
Yaml syntax home assistant. yaml. The standards described on this page, apply to all our Y...